新聞中心
在網(wǎng)頁開發(fā)中,HTML是一種基本的標(biāo)記語言,用于創(chuàng)建和組織網(wǎng)頁內(nèi)容,通過使用HTML,我們可以定義網(wǎng)頁的結(jié)構(gòu)、樣式和行為,在本回答中,我將詳細(xì)介紹如何設(shè)定HTML事件。

員工經(jīng)過長(zhǎng)期磨合與沉淀,具備了協(xié)作精神,得以通過團(tuán)隊(duì)的力量開發(fā)出優(yōu)質(zhì)的產(chǎn)品。創(chuàng)新互聯(lián)堅(jiān)持“專注、創(chuàng)新、易用”的產(chǎn)品理念,因?yàn)椤皩W⑺詫I(yè)、創(chuàng)新互聯(lián)網(wǎng)站所以易用所以簡(jiǎn)單”。公司專注于為企業(yè)提供網(wǎng)站設(shè)計(jì)、成都網(wǎng)站制作、微信公眾號(hào)開發(fā)、電商網(wǎng)站開發(fā),小程序設(shè)計(jì),軟件按需定制網(wǎng)站等一站式互聯(lián)網(wǎng)企業(yè)服務(wù)。
1、什么是HTML事件?
HTML事件是瀏覽器對(duì)用戶操作的一種響應(yīng),例如點(diǎn)擊按鈕、鼠標(biāo)移動(dòng)等,當(dāng)用戶執(zhí)行某個(gè)操作時(shí),瀏覽器會(huì)觸發(fā)相應(yīng)的事件,為了處理這些事件,我們需要編寫JavaScript代碼。
2、HTML事件的基本結(jié)構(gòu)
HTML事件的基本結(jié)構(gòu)包括以下幾個(gè)部分:
事件類型:表示要觸發(fā)的事件類型,如"click"、"mouseover"等。
事件屬性:用于傳遞事件的相關(guān)信息,如"src"、"alt"等。
事件處理器:用于處理事件的JavaScript函數(shù)。
3、常見的HTML事件類型
以下是一些常見的HTML事件類型:
click:當(dāng)用戶點(diǎn)擊元素時(shí)觸發(fā)。
mousedown:當(dāng)用戶按下鼠標(biāo)按鈕時(shí)觸發(fā)。
mouseup:當(dāng)用戶松開鼠標(biāo)按鈕時(shí)觸發(fā)。
mousemove:當(dāng)鼠標(biāo)在元素上移動(dòng)時(shí)觸發(fā)。
mouseover:當(dāng)鼠標(biāo)移動(dòng)到元素上時(shí)觸發(fā)。
mouseout:當(dāng)鼠標(biāo)從元素上移出時(shí)觸發(fā)。
keydown:當(dāng)用戶按下鍵盤鍵時(shí)觸發(fā)。
keyup:當(dāng)用戶松開鍵盤鍵時(shí)觸發(fā)。
keypress:當(dāng)用戶按下并釋放鍵盤鍵時(shí)觸發(fā)。
load:當(dāng)頁面加載完成時(shí)觸發(fā)。
unload:當(dāng)頁面卸載(關(guān)閉)時(shí)觸發(fā)。
resize:當(dāng)瀏覽器窗口大小改變時(shí)觸發(fā)。
scroll:當(dāng)用戶滾動(dòng)頁面時(shí)觸發(fā)。
4、如何為HTML元素添加事件?
為HTML元素添加事件,我們需要使用JavaScript代碼,以下是一個(gè)簡(jiǎn)單的示例:
在這個(gè)示例中,我們?yōu)橐粋€(gè)按鈕元素添加了一個(gè)click事件,當(dāng)用戶點(diǎn)擊按鈕時(shí),會(huì)彈出一個(gè)提示框顯示"按鈕被點(diǎn)擊了!",我們通過在標(biāo)簽中添加onclick屬性來實(shí)現(xiàn)這一點(diǎn),該屬性的值是一個(gè)調(diào)用handleClick函數(shù)的JavaScript代碼。
5、如何為HTML元素添加多個(gè)事件?
可以為HTML元素添加多個(gè)事件,只需用逗號(hào)分隔即可,以下是一個(gè)簡(jiǎn)單的示例:
在這個(gè)示例中,我們?yōu)橐粋€(gè)按鈕元素添加了兩個(gè)事件:click和mouseover,當(dāng)用戶點(diǎn)擊或移動(dòng)鼠標(biāo)到按鈕上時(shí),都會(huì)彈出相應(yīng)的提示框,我們通過在標(biāo)簽中添加onclick和onmouseover屬性來實(shí)現(xiàn)這一點(diǎn),這兩個(gè)屬性的值分別是調(diào)用handleClick和handleMouseover函數(shù)的JavaScript代碼。
6、如何移除HTML元素的事件?
可以使用removeEventListener方法來移除HTML元素的事件,以下是一個(gè)簡(jiǎn)單的示例:
在這個(gè)示例中,我們?yōu)橐粋€(gè)按鈕元素添加了一個(gè)click事件,當(dāng)用戶點(diǎn)擊第一個(gè)按鈕時(shí),會(huì)彈出一個(gè)提示框顯示"按鈕被點(diǎn)擊了!";當(dāng)用戶點(diǎn)擊第二個(gè)按鈕時(shí),會(huì)移除第一個(gè)按鈕的click事件,我們通過在標(biāo)簽中添加onclick屬性來實(shí)現(xiàn)這一點(diǎn),該屬性的值是一個(gè)調(diào)用handleClick函數(shù)的JavaScript代碼,在removeClickHandler函數(shù)中,我們使用removeEventListener方法來移除第一個(gè)按鈕的click事件。
當(dāng)前題目:事件html如何設(shè)定
文章網(wǎng)址:http://m.fisionsoft.com.cn/article/dpeehoj.html


咨詢
建站咨詢
